Plots(1)
After hearing that children are going missing all over, Mana contacts Kitaro and the others and is ready to go with them to discover the truth behind the incidents, but Kitaro turns her down, saying that humans and youkai can't be friends. It's soon clear that a yokai that had once been sealed away is taking children to build a yokai castle. Then, Mana is abducted. Kitaro goes to rescue Mana with the Sand-throwing Hag and the Child's-cry Old Man! (Crunchyroll)
